Description

While visiting Wyoming, Lucas Foglia photographed a gas station instead of Yellowstone or Grand Teton National Park. Without the national highway system, cars, and the oil fields, refineries and gas stations that enable the cars to run, those scenic wonders would be inaccessible to most people. Even in this scene of commerce, we treasure the glimpse of a hillside.
